Browse Source

Test

etomic
jl777 7 years ago
parent
commit
cd5f624e73
  1. 3
      iguana/exchanges/LP_nativeDEX.c
  2. 8
      iguana/exchanges/LP_ordermatch.c

3
iguana/exchanges/LP_nativeDEX.c

@ -18,9 +18,6 @@
// LP_nativeDEX.c // LP_nativeDEX.c
// marketmaker // marketmaker
// //
// detecting new deposits in inventory
// bot progress
// swap started event for bot
// bot status 1600% ? // bot status 1600% ?
// BCH signing // BCH signing

8
iguana/exchanges/LP_ordermatch.c

@ -1010,15 +1010,15 @@ char *LP_autobuy(void *ctx,char *myipaddr,int32_t mypubsock,char *base,char *rel
destsatoshis = SATOSHIDEN * relvolume; destsatoshis = SATOSHIDEN * relvolume;
if ( (autxo= LP_utxo_bestfit(rel,destsatoshis + 2*desttxfee)) == 0 ) if ( (autxo= LP_utxo_bestfit(rel,destsatoshis + 2*desttxfee)) == 0 )
return(clonestr("{\"error\":\"cant find alice utxo that is big enough\"}")); return(clonestr("{\"error\":\"cant find alice utxo that is big enough\"}"));
if ( destsatoshis - 0*desttxfee < autxo->S.satoshis ) if ( destsatoshis - desttxfee < autxo->S.satoshis )
{ {
//destsatoshis -= 2*desttxfee; destsatoshis -= desttxfee;
autxo->S.satoshis = destsatoshis; autxo->S.satoshis = destsatoshis;
//printf("first path dest %.8f from %.8f\n",dstr(destsatoshis),dstr(autxo->S.satoshis)); //printf("first path dest %.8f from %.8f\n",dstr(destsatoshis),dstr(autxo->S.satoshis));
} }
else if ( autxo->S.satoshis - 0*desttxfee < destsatoshis ) else if ( autxo->S.satoshis - desttxfee < destsatoshis )
{ {
autxo->S.satoshis -= 0*desttxfee; autxo->S.satoshis -= desttxfee;
destsatoshis = autxo->S.satoshis; destsatoshis = autxo->S.satoshis;
printf("second path dest %.8f from %.8f\n",dstr(destsatoshis),dstr(autxo->S.satoshis)); printf("second path dest %.8f from %.8f\n",dstr(destsatoshis),dstr(autxo->S.satoshis));
} }

Loading…
Cancel
Save